Spamworldpro Mini Shell
Spamworldpro


Server : Apache
System : Linux server2.corals.io 4.18.0-348.2.1.el8_5.x86_64 #1 SMP Mon Nov 15 09:17:08 EST 2021 x86_64
User : corals ( 1002)
PHP Version : 7.4.33
Disable Function : exec,passthru,shell_exec,system
Directory :  /home/corals/mcoil.corals.io/app/Http/Controllers/Admin/InvoiceSetting/

Upload File :
current_dir [ Writeable ] document_root [ Writeable ]

 

Current File : /home/corals/mcoil.corals.io/app/Http/Controllers/Admin/InvoiceSetting/InvoiceSettingController.php
<?php

namespace App\Http\Controllers\Admin\InvoiceSetting;

use Illuminate\Http\Request;
use App\Http\Controllers\Controller;
use App\Shop\InvoiceSettings\InvoiceSetting;
use App\Shop\InvoiceSettings\Requests\UpdateInvoiceSettingRequest;
use Illuminate\Support\Facades\DB;

class InvoiceSettingController extends Controller
{
    /**
     * Display a listing of the resource.
     *
     * @param Request $request
     *
     * @return \Illuminate\Http\Response
     */
    public function index(Request $request) {
        $invoiceSetting = InvoiceSetting::where("key","invoice_footer")->first();
        return view('admin.invoiceSetting.list', ['invoiceSetting' => $invoiceSetting]);
    }

    /**
     * Update the specified resource in storage.
     *
     * @param  UpdateInvoiceSettingRequest $request
     * @param  int  $id
     * @return \Illuminate\Http\Response
     */
    public function update(UpdateInvoiceSettingRequest $request, $id) {
    	$invoiceSetting = InvoiceSetting::find($id);

        if ($invoiceSetting) {
	       $invoiceSetting->message = $request->message;
	       $invoiceSetting->save();
        }
        return redirect()->route('admin.invoice-settings')->with('message', 'Message updated successfully.');
    }
}

Spamworldpro Mini